Eligible Classes

 Regular Seat

 Class J

  • *All seats on JAC routes, HAC routes, and RAC routes are "Regular Seats".
  • *Class J Awards are not available on some domestic routes and flights.
  • *First Class award ticket is not available. However you may board on First Class by paying a surcharge if you hold either an Economy Class award ticket or Class J award ticket provided that First Class seats are available at the airport on the day of departure. (Advance reservation for First Class is not permitted if your base ticket is a JMB award ticket. You cannot board on First Class by using your mileage at the airport on the day of departure.)

Conditions for Using Awards

Itineraries
All flights must be confirmed at the time of mileage redemption.
Any 2 flight sectors can be included in 1 award.
  • * All award flight sectors must be on direct flight.
  • * Haneda and Narita airports in Tokyo are considered to be the same city, as are Itami and Kansai airports in Osaka, Chitose and Okadama airports in Sapporo or Chubu and Komaki airports in Nagoya.
  • * In the event that 2 flight sectors of JTA/RAC neighbor island routes are combined with Hokkaido/Honshu/Shikoku/Kyushu-Okinawa(Naha, Ishigaki, Miyako, Kumejima) routes on JAL/JTA with an additional 5,000 miles, the same flight sector cannot be used when going in the same direction.

Validity/Changes to Award Tickets After Mileage Redemption

Validity of Awards
Award tickets once issued are valid only for the flight and date reserved. If an earlier flight on the day of departure is available, you may board the earlier flight provided it is of the same flight sector. Failure to travel will result in the forfeiture of the award ticket, and refund of mileage*1 or change of award may not be available.
The validity of Award tickets are 90 days from the next day of the ticket issuance (date mileage was redeemed), only if the reservation change was made within the date change deadline. The validity of Awards using discount mileage is the earlier of the validity mentioned for Awards tickets or the final date set for the discount period. All travel must be completed within the validity.

*Other rules and conditions may apply to Campaigns where Awards can be redeemed for less mileage.
*1 Mileage refund of unused award tickets is not applicable to this case. Moreover, mileage refund is not available upon the departure of the flight of the first reserved sector.

Changes to award tickets upon mileage redemption
Date changes are permitted provided that the flight sector, direction and class remain unchanged. Date change is possible before the deadline listed below through the JAL Group office of your membership reservation or through the JAL website. However, change of traveler’s name, flight sector, class of service, type of award, and changes to open itineraries are not permitted.
Please contact the JAL Group office of your membership registration for changes that are not mentioned above.
*Reservation change for Awards using discount mileage is possible only through the JAL website.

*When changes are made to Class J award tickets, Class J for the new flight/ date may not be available or scheduled. In such cases, Class Y may have to be taken instead, and mileage for the Class J portion will not be reinstated.
*When you wish to change your regular seat to Class J at the airport on the day of departure, please go through the upgrade procedure at the airport ticketing counter and mention that required mileage for Class J has already been deducted.
*If an earlier flight on the day of departure is available at the airport, you may board the earlier flight provided it is of the same flight sector.
*Upgrade to "Class J" from regular seat on Domestic Award Tickets are available with an additional 2,000 miles for 1 flight sector per person. If Class J are available at the time of departure, you may travel in Class J by paying the Class J surcharge.
*Other rules and conditions may apply to Campaigns where Awards can be redeemed for less mileage.

Deadlines for changing reservations
Reservation must be changed at least 4 days before the new departure date of the flight sector or before the original departure date and time of the flight sector (whichever comes first).
However, the journey must be completed within the validity of the award tickets.

How to Request Awards

Deadline for Award Request and Processing
Award booking will be accepted from 9:30 (Japan time) 2 months (the same day of the month) prior to the date of departure until 4 days (excluding the departure date) prior to departure. Award booking through the JAL website is possible until 23:59* p.m. 4 days prior to departure.
Where to Request
1. JAL Homepage ……… Please click on the “Award Ticket Reservation” on the top right-hand corner of the website upon user login. (Some restrictions apply.)

2. JAL Group Office of your membership registration ……… Please provide your JMB membership number when making requests through the telephone.
*Please confirm the telephone number before making requests.
*Application of Awards using discount mileage is possible only through the JAL website within the eligible period. Application by telephone is not permitted.


Notes on Award Request
Please make sure that you have the required number of miles at the time you request an award. You cannot request an award if you do not have the required mileage.
Please be noted that waitlists are not permitted for award reservations of domestic sectors.
Wailtlisted reservations for the domestic flights of the international award tickets are not permitted.
Moreover, please be aware that domestic award tickets require confirmed reservation of all requested sectors. The award will not be issued until your reservation has been confirmed. Once the reservation is confirmed, the award application will be completed by deducting the necessary miles from your JMB account and issuing the award.
Application of Awards using discount mileage is possible only through the JAL website within the eligible period.

Notes on Award Requests made through the Internet
For each reservation, reservation of 2 flight sectors (and an additional 2 flight sectors if your itinerary includes Okinawa routes to the neighboring islands), or for oneway travel, reservation of 1 flight sector in one transaction is necessary. Please note that mileage for 2 flight sectors will be deducted even if only 1 flight sector is necessary for travel. Also, after applying for an oneway award ticket, and completing reservation process through the JAL website, addition of a second flight sector at a later transaction is not permitted. Combination of standard mileage and discount mileage is not permitted.
